As an irrelevant aside, the river Thames where it is passing through Oxford is known as the river Isis (historically a university oddity, I guess, but now enshrined in the Ordnance Survey's maps). Sadly, this is nothing to do with the god, but is simply another way of abbreviating the Latin name of Thamesis.
